Lowering a cement pipe into a drilled motor-pumped well

Lowering a cement pipe into a drilled motor-pumped well (referred to as pipe lowering into the well) is a key step in motor-pumped well construction. Its core purpose is to protect the well wall, stabilize the well body, and ensure the quality of well water and water extraction efficiency. The specific reasons are mainly as follows:

1. Preventing well wall collapse

A motor-pumped well is formed by drilling underground with drilling equipment. The soil or rocks around the well wall may be unstable due to being loose, easily weathered (such as sandy soil layers, gravel layers) or scoured by groundwater. After lowering the cement pipe, the pipe body can directly support the well wall, preventing the well wall from collapsing due to loss of support after drilling and maintaining the structural integrity of the well.

2. Filtering impurities and purifying water quality

Cement pipes usually have reserved water filter holes on the pipe wall, and when lowering the pipe, filter materials (such as fine sand, filter screens) are wrapped around the outside of the pipe. When groundwater seeps into the well, the water filter holes and filter materials can block impurities such as soil particles and sediment from entering the pipe, reduce the sand content in the well water, ensure clean water quality during water extraction, and avoid impurities blocking water pumps and other water extraction equipment.

3. Fixing the depth and scope of the well

After the cement pipe is lowered to the specified depth, it can clarify the effective water extraction section of the well (i.e., the position of the aquifer corresponding to the water filter holes of the pipe body), avoid the mixing of shallow poor-quality groundwater (such as polluted surface water infiltration layers), and at the same time prevent the actual water extraction scope of the well from deviating due to turbulent water flow during water extraction.

4. Extending the service life of the motor-pumped well

Without the protection of the well pipe, the well wall is easily eroded and scoured by groundwater for a long time, or the wellbore may shrink or even be scrapped due to the growth of underground microorganisms and mineral deposition. Cement pipes have stable chemical properties and strong corrosion resistance, which can isolate the direct contact between the well wall and groundwater, reduce well body damage, and extend the service life of the motor-pumped well.

In summary, lowering the cement pipe is an important measure to ensure the safe and stable operation of the motor-pumped well and ensure the quality and efficiency of water extraction. It is especially essential in areas with complex geological conditions (such as loose strata and multiple aquifers).
